What is Teeth Whitening?

Teeth whitening, or bleaching, is an effective way to change the colour of your natural teeth, so you can feel more comfortable showing off your smile! Teeth whitening can effectively restore teeth that are dull, stained, darkened, or discoloured due to things like tea, coffee, cola, wine, berries, smoking or general ageing, and it can brighten the natural pigmentation of the teeth. Even traumatic injuries, medications, and fluorosis can affect the colour of your teeth. Unfortunately, brushing and flossing your teeth is not enough to remove these stains.

Types of Teeth Whitening:

In-office Zoom teeth whitening is performed by your dentist at our clinic. It is a bleaching process used to lighten the discoloration of enamel and dentin. The whitening procedure uses the Philips Zoom Advanced Lamp to activate the Zoom 25 percent hydrogen peroxide whitening gel that is applied to your teeth. As the hydrogen peroxide is broken down, oxygen enters the enamel and dentin, and starts the bleaching process, without affecting the structure of the tooth.

In just one appointment, a professional Zoom tooth whitening experience can give you a brilliant and healthy smile that can last for years.

Before deciding whether Zoom in-office teeth whitening is right for you, we will conduct a comprehensive examination of your teeth and gums to ensure proper health, as well as talk with you about your oral hygiene and lifestyle habits to determine if you will benefit from whitening. This will help decide on the whitening product or technique that is best suited for you.

Teeth whitening can also be considered if you are planning other cosmetic procedures, such as veneers or composite bonding, in order to ensure a colour match between your restoration and your natural dentition.

Depending on the condition of your teeth and your particular goals for changing the look of your smile, teeth whitening may not be an ideal solution for every patient. During your consultation and evaluation, we will assess your existing dental work, such as crowns and veneers, which will not respond to conventional whitening agents. Treatment time varies from patient to patient but is generally completed in just one 60-minute appointment. A regular teeth cleaning is recommended prior to the actual Zoom teeth whitening session, which will remove plaque and tartar, so the treatment application is even on your enamel. The procedure consists of a short preparation to completely cover the lips and gums, leaving only the teeth exposed. After that, the Zoom hydrogen peroxide whitening gel is applied to the teeth. The gel is then exposed to the Philips Zoom Advanced LED light, which will start to activate the Zoom 25% hydrogen peroxide gel, causing it to penetrate the teeth and break up the stains and discoloration. During this time, you can relax, watch TV, or listen to music. Teeth whitening has never been this safe – and this comfortable!

To help maintain the whitening effects of this treatment, it is important to avoid certain foods and beverages or consume them in moderation to avoid staining your teeth. Do not smoke immediately after treatment – wait for at least two hours. Foods and drinks containing strong colours, like tea, coffee, red wine, cola, or fruit juices, should be avoided for at least 48 hours, or consumed in moderation.

The best way to sustain your results is to follow a good oral care routine at home with regular brushing, flossing, and mouthwash rinsing. It is also important to see your dentist and hygienist regularly for scheduled teeth cleanings.

Anti-sensitivity toothpaste is recommended post-treatment.

Bleaching should be done only under a dentist’s care. Sensitivity during the treatment may occur in some cases, and some minor tingling is experienced immediately after the procedure, but always dissipates.

Please note that teeth whitening is an elective cosmetic procedure, so it is typically not covered by dental insurance. The procedure costs are therefore not covered by most insurance plans. Professional take-home teeth whitening kits are a fast, safe, and effective way to professionally whiten your teeth while in the comfort of your own home. It usually requires two visits. At the first appointment, an impression (mould) will be made of your teeth in order to fabricate a custom, clear plastic tray. At your second appointment, you will try on the trays to ensure a proper fit, and any necessary adjustments will be made. You will be sent home with your custom trays, along with a whitening gel made up of hydrogen peroxide. The trays are filled with gel and applied over your teeth and worn for 30 minutes a day. It is normal to experience some degree of tooth sensitivity during the course of treatment, but it will subside shortly after you have stopped bleaching.
